Angelina Jolie DCMG, the American actor, director of films, humanitarian, and author is a DCMG. She has won numerous awards such as the three Golden Globe Awards and an Academy Award. Angelina Jolie was recognized multiple times for her unwavering dedication to help others. In 2005 Jolie received the Global Humanitarian Achievement Award from the United Nations Association of the USA to promote her advocacy for the rights of refugees.
